On Sat 3rd April, we celebrate the sounds of one of the defining British voices of the 00s, as Sound of the Lioness return to our main stage for the first time since their sold out show at the venue in January.
Formed in 2016, Sound of The Lioness is an 8-piece band with the goal of paying an authentic homage to the music of the late Amy Winehouse.
Complete with a full horn section (including Baritone sax and flute) and drawing inspiration from her incredible performances, the band accurately recreates the live sound of Amy’s touring bands of the 2000s, ranging from the jazz-inflection of the Frank era (2004) to the soul-drenched Mark Ronson style of the Back to Black years (2006-7).
Expect to hear some of her greatest hits like:
Valerie, Back to Black, Tears Dry On Their Own, Rehab, Me & Mr. Jones, Monkey Man, Love Is a Losing Game, Will You Still Love Me, You Know I’m No Good, Stronger Than Me and many more deep cuts.
